The term "private" often refers to facilities that are privately owned, as opposed to being run by a county or state entity. This can sometimes mean a wider variety of amenities or specialized care models. The first, most crucial step is to understand your loved one’s specific needs. Are they recovering from a surgery or stroke requiring intensive rehabilitation? Do they have a progressive condition like advanced dementia or Parkinson’s that necessitates specialized memory care? Having a clear picture from their doctor about the level of skilled nursing required will immediately narrow your search to homes equipped for those clinical needs.
Once you have a shortlist, nothing replaces an in-person visit. Call ahead to schedule a tour, but also consider dropping in unannounced if the facility allows it. This gives you a more authentic view of daily life. Pay attention to the details that matter: Is the environment clean and free of lingering odors? Do the staff members interact warmly with residents, using their names and speaking with respect? Observe the residents themselves. Do they seem engaged, well-groomed, and content? In our rural setting, also consider the home’s connection to the broader community. Do local groups visit? Is there easy access to outdoor spaces for enjoying Iowa’s changing seasons, and are pathways cleared safely in winter?
Financing private nursing home care is a significant consideration for most families. It’s essential to have frank conversations with administrators about all costs, what is included, and their policies regarding Medicaid. Many private homes in Iowa accept Medicaid, but often only after a resident has spent down personal assets. Meeting with a financial advisor or an elder law attorney familiar with Iowa’s regulations can provide invaluable guidance on protecting assets and navigating this complex process.
